One important note: spinal alignment also depends on pillow height and bed base quality. A foam mattress on slats wider than 7cm will undermine even the best mattress. Ensure your base is appropriate before attributing any alignment issues to the mattress itself.
If you sleep hot — and in Australia's climate, many people do — cooling is a non-negotiable factor. We weight temperature regulation at 20% of our overall score, higher than most US-based review sites, because Australian summers genuinely demand it.
The Onebed Original Mattress's hybrid construction gives it a natural cooling advantage. The pocket spring base creates airflow channels through the mattress body, allowing heat to dissipate rather than accumulate at the sleep surface. This makes it one of the better-performing mattresses for temperature regulation in our testing.
For very hot sleepers in Queensland or WA, pairing with linen or bamboo bedding will significantly improve overnight temperatures regardless of the mattress chosen.

In terms of durability, a well-maintained Onebed Original Mattress should last 7–10 years under normal usage. Using a quality mattress protector from day one significantly extends this lifespan by preventing moisture and debris from reaching the foam layers.
